Rosie O’Donnell just can’t let it go. She’s currently slamming The View for claiming that ratings are up now that she’s no longer on the show. She blathered on and on in a blog entry about how they’re saying ratings are up +16% and that she doesn’t buy it. (I don’t know. Personally, *I* watch it more often now. I prefer Whoopi Goldberg by a mile.)

Rosie wrote:

“While im all about creative use of ratings, I think we need to do something with the lovely people at the view insisting that the ratings are up without rosie when in fact they are not…

Here is the real data based on live plus same day viewing:

P2+ 3,576 + 7.8%
HH 2.8 rating versus 2.66 YAG + 5.3%
W 18- 49 1.47 versus 1.6 YAG – 8.8%
W 25-54 1.77 versus 1.92 YAG – 8.5%
W 18-34 1.03 versus 1.23 YAG – 19.4%
W 50+ 2.3 versus 2.13 YAG + 8.0 %

Note that the show is bought from an advertising perspective which is their only revenue stream on either the W 18-49 or 25-54 demo meaning they are LOSING revenue versus YAG. Also, the most valuable demo is the younger one 18-34 which is really hemmoraging. They are picking up older viewers 50+ which are of less value to advertisers.

Again – they should really use the ACTUAL REAL numbers in their press statements and if they don’t, then maybe we should…..
